The Philippine Coast Guard is looking to acquire
Defender-Class Boats in its bid to strengthen its Maritime Law Enforcement
capabilities under the government of President Rodrigo Duterte.
Defender-Class Boats, also known as Response Boat–Small
(RB-S), is a 25-feet boat introduced by the United States Coast Guard (USCG) in
2002.

Moreover, Defender-Class Boats serve the USCG, US Border
Patrol, US Navy, and several other navies including Israel.
According to US Coast Guard, the RB-S became the platform to
increase the long term homeland security capability at shore stations in the
wake of September 11, 2001 terrorist attack.
